A firewall can help prevent DDoS attacks by monitoring incoming traffic and filtering out malicious requests that exceed predefined thresholds. By implementing rules that block or limit excessive traffic from specific IP addresses or geographic regions, firewalls can reduce the impact of an attack. Additionally, advanced firewalls can use anomaly detection to identify and mitigate unusual traffic patterns indicative of a DDoS attack. However, while firewalls are a crucial line of defense, they may not completely eliminate the risk, necessitating a layered security approach.
